Ingredients
-
½cuphoney
-
¼cupminced garlic
-
¼cupsoy sauce
-
3tablespoonsonion powder
-
2tablespoonsgarlic powder
-
1 ½teaspoonschili powder (Optional)
-
3poundsground moose
-
2tablespoonscanola oil
Cooking Directions
-
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
-
Stir together honey, garlic, and soy sauce in a small saucepan, then stir in onion, garlic, and chili powders. Bring to a simmer over medium-high heat. Reduce the heat to medium-low and gently simmer for 15 minutes.
-
While the sauce is simmering, roll 2 tablespoons ground moose into a ball. Repeat to make remaining meatballs.
-
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ook meatballs in batches until well browned and cooked through, 10 to 15 minutes per batch; drain well.
-
Transfer drained meatballs to a large baking dish. Pour in sauce and stir until meatballs are well coated.
-
Bake in the preheated oven until meatballs absorb some sauce and an instant-read thermometer inserted into the centers reads 160 degrees F (70 degrees C), about 20 minutes.
